My newspaper today had an obituary for Alain de Cadanet, the racing driver who died at the beginning of this month.
Apparently his first car was an M-type. Anybody got any idea as to which M this was.??
The little story accompanying this tells that the old chap selling him the car, pointed out a switch down by his right leg. If you move the switch the engine will stop, This was very useful when out with a young lady. You could then cuddle up to keep warm in the roofless M-type.
Sadly there wasn't one my car = I suppose it is a little too late to install one now. |
